Released in 1938, The Curtain Rises is a comedy and drama film directed by Marc Allégret.

What it’s about. François, Cécilia and Isabelle are students of the drama class of the Conservatoire led by Professor Lambertin. François is in love with Isabelle who also loves him, but he is pursued by Cecilia, his former mistress. Cécilia commits suicide staging the suicide like a crime, so as to involve Francis. But a testimony restores the truth.

Who’s in it. The Curtain Rises stars Claude Dauphin as François Polti, Janine Darcey as Isabelle, Louis Jouvet as Professeur Lambertin and Odette Joyeux as Cécilia, among others.
